A modular Swift SDK for audio processing with MLX on Apple Silicon
Process audio and convert speech to text or text to speech using a modular Swift toolkit on Apple devices.

mlx-audio-swift has 711 stars on GitHub. It has been forked 133 times. mlx-audio-swift is written mainly in Swift. It has been in active development since 2025. mlx-audio-swift is available under the MIT license. Its main topics are mlx, mlx-audio, mlx-audio-swift, mlx-swift-audio.
